Big 5’s Q4 Profits Slide 38%
Big 5 Sporting Goods Corp. reported sales in the fourth quarter slid 4.6% to $226.7 million and were down 0.7% on a same-store basis. Net earnings dropped 37.5% to $4.0 million, or 18 cents per share, from $6.4 million, or 29 cents, a year ago…
